What Sowed Its Seeds?
Since its launch in 2023, Dandelion has deeply moved the global animation and film industry. Earned accolades from over 40 international film festivals, including reputable stages such as SIGGRAPH, SIGGRAPH Asia, and Ars Electronica. Notably, it clinched the Best Animation at the DaVinci International Film Festival and won the heart of the audience in Europe and the United States.
More significantly, the film managed to connect with varied audiences on different levels. Some perceive it as a graceful narrative about liberation and resilience, while others perceive it from the standpoint of nature, technology, or human optimism. However, the wide acceptance validated that animation indeed has the power to transcend linguistic barriers, directly touching human sentiments.
Peeking Behind the Scenes…
Dandelion was conceived as a reflection of our joint experiences as international artists based in Florida. The long nights of project development in stark contrast to the peaceful coastal walks, created a potent metaphor for the story – the drive of the digital and the tranquillity of nature.
We intended to delve into the conflict between ideals and reality, personal vision and social forces. In the film, the robot symbolizes linear control and obedience, while the dandelion epitomizes liberty, purity and the quest for one’s innate truth. As artists in a foreign culture, we found striking similarities with these experiences. Hence, this film is an abstract representation of our journey through these emotions.
The Creation Process
Dandelion shaped up as an entirely independent animation short during our tenure at the Ringling College of Art and Design. Our project took off in late 2022 and saw the light of day in May 2023. We focused on building a visually appealing narrative that relied less on dialogue and more on emotive communication.
The creation process was intense and necessitated strong collaboration. We poured over the design, animation, lighting, and rendering of every scene. We adopted top-notch 3D tools and paid special attention to filmography, contrast, and symbolic compositions. We aspired to craft a narrative that felt poetic yet realistic, expressive yet controlled.
However, we were most keen to ensure that the film remained open to interpretations. Regardless of whether one perceives it as a commentary on freedom, a discourse about nature and technology, or a tale of rebellion and hope, we aimed for the film to hold a unique space in every viewer’s heart.
